Sustainability: The Core of Resilience

Our mission to safeguard data goes hand in hand with our commitment to safeguard the environment. In FY25, we made meaningful progress toward our climate resilience goals:

  • Scope 2 emissions dropped by over 13%, driven by smarter energy use and efficient data center operations.
  • Emissions intensity fell from 12.7 to 9.6 metric tons CO₂e per million USD revenue, showing that growth and sustainability can move forward together.
  • Our LEED-certified headquarters continues to lead with renewable energy integration, water-efficient systems, and robust recycling programs.

In everything from how we power our offices to how we design our technology, we consider sustainability a key driver of business continuity.

Collective Action, Shared Progress

We know climate action is not a solo mission. That’s why Commvault collaborates with partners who share our environmental values and participates in community initiatives like the Net Zero Institute to help accelerate the transition to a low-carbon economy.

We also align our climate governance with the Task Force on Climate-Related Financial Disclosures (TCFD), driving accountability from the top down.
